Humidity and Finish Quality
Humidity significantly impacts the surface quality of industrial paint jobs. When moisture levels are high, moisture in the air can interfere with the drying out process of paint. This can result in concerns like inadequate attachment, unequal finishes, and boosted drying out times.
You could locate that your paint takes longer to treat, which can delay your job timeline.
On the other hand, reduced humidity can additionally pose issues. If the air is as well dry, paint can dry also rapidly, protecting against correct progressing and resulting in a rough surface. https://www.mirror.co.uk/news/weird-news/interior-expert-warns-against-painting-29730357 desire your paint to stream smoothly, and fast drying out can hinder that, leaving you with an unacceptable surface.
To accomplish the very best surface, go for humidity degrees between 40% and 70%. This range enables optimal drying out conditions, making sure that the paint adheres well and levels out effectively.
Take into consideration utilizing dehumidifiers or fans to manage moisture in interior jobs, and attempt to intend outdoor jobs for days when moisture is within the perfect variety. By paying attention to moisture, you can enhance the final appearance and durability of your industrial paint work.
Wind and Outside Problems
While you mightn't consider wind as a significant aspect, it can considerably influence the outcome of exterior commercial painting tasks. High winds can disrupt your application process, triggering paint to completely dry too promptly. When paint dries as well quickly, it can lead to an irregular finish or visible brush strokes.
You'll also face obstacles with paint overspray, as wind can carry fragments away from the desired surface area, causing thrown away products and possible damages to bordering areas.
In addition, strong gusts can develop safety threats at work website. Ladders and scaffolding are more vulnerable to tipping in gusty conditions, placing your crew in danger. It's essential to keep track of wind rates before starting a job. If winds go beyond safe restrictions, it's ideal to postpone your job to ensure a high quality coating and preserve safety.
On calmer days, you can make the most of the ideal problems to accomplish smooth, professional results. Constantly check the weather prediction and plan accordingly.
